Zora Folley - American heavyweight fighter who lost to Muhammad Ali. It was lamented by those knowledgeable about boxing that Folley never got his shot at the championship until he was quite old because he was so good that the other contenders were careful to avoid fighting him. This prevented Folley from being able to be ranked high enough to get a chance at the title until his late thirties.
